一种发动机抖动抑制的方法与流程

专利查询6月前  45



1.本发明涉及汽车发动机技术领域,尤其是一种发动机抖动抑制的方法。


背景技术:

2.混合动力汽车采用发动机带动电机进行发电给动力电池充电。发动机输出转矩存在周期性抖动,抖动的周期和发动机的机械转动周期相关。如图2所示,发动机在2个转动机械周期内(720度)输出转矩engine torque有4次脉动,冲击转矩的峰值超过200nm,但是发动机输出的平均转矩engine mean torque只有约100nm。发动机的转矩脉动如果不抑制,则会造成机械系统振动,影响舒适性何机械寿命。
3.为了减小发动机抖动,保证机械系统平稳,一般会在发动机输出端增加减震器,平滑发动机的输出扭矩。增加减震器会增加系统体积和成本,因此需要电动机取代减震器,平滑机械轴上的输出转矩。


技术实现要素:

4.本发明的目的是:克服现有技术中的不足,提供一种发动机抖动抑制的方法。
5.为解决上述技术问题,本发明采用的技术方案如下:一种发动机抖动抑制的方法,包括以下步骤:s1:用正弦波发生器输出调整转矩t_delt;s2:输出的调整转矩t_delt经过加法器与正常电机控制转矩t_cmd相加后得到最终电机转矩输出值t_real并将最终电机转矩输出值t_real给到电机;s3:速度传感器得到电机转速spd,并对电机转速spd进行均方差计算得到转速均方差sqrerr;s4:自适应调节器根据转速均方差sqrerr来调整正弦波发生器输出调整转矩t_delt的幅值amp和相位phase,以使得转速均方差sqrerr值最小。
6.进一步的,正弦波发生器输出的调整转矩t_delt的频率与发动机转矩脉动的频率相同。
7.进一步的,所述调整转矩t_delt需要根据电机的输出转矩能力进行最大值限制和最小值限制。
8.进一步的,自适应调节器在调整幅值amp和相位phase时优先调整相位phase。
9.采用本发明的技术方案的有益效果是:1、本发明通过调整电机的输出转矩来实现发动机转矩的平滑,抑制发动机的转矩脉动,减少机械系统振动,延长机械使用寿命,提升舒适性。
10.2、优先调节相位,保证补偿转矩刚好削弱发动机的抖动,然后再调正弦波幅值,使得抖动抑制的效果最佳。
附图说明
11.为了更清楚地说明本发明实施例的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其它的附图。其中图1为发动机与电机的连接示意图;图2为发动机输出转矩的典型波形图;图3为本方法及系统的示意图。
具体实施方式
12.现在结合附图对本发明作进一步详细的说明。这些附图均为简化的示意图,仅以示意方式说明本发明的基本结构,因此其仅显示与本发明有关的构成。本发明利用结构示意图等进行详细描述,示意图只是实例,其在此不应限制本发明保护的范围。此外,在实际制作中应包含长度、宽度及深度的三维空间。
13.如图1所示,发动机通过机械同轴连接到电机,电机由电机控制器提供三相交流电,电机控制器通过发挥制动转矩将电机机械能转换为动力电池的电能。
14.本发明的思路是增加一个电机的补偿转矩(如图2中的motor comp torque 曲线)来抑制电机的转矩脉动。
15.如图3所示,一种发动机抖动抑制的方法,包括以下步骤:s1:用正弦波发生器输出调整转矩t_delt,t_delt如图2中的motor comp torque 曲线;s2:输出的调整转矩t_delt经过加法器与正常电机控制转矩t_cmd相加后得到最终电机转矩输出值t_real并将最终电机转矩输出值t_real给到电机;s3:速度传感器得到电机转速spd,并对电机转速spd进行均方差计算得到转速均方差sqrerr;s4:自适应调节器根据转速均方差sqrerr来调整正弦波发生器输出调整转矩t_delt的幅值amp和相位phase,以使得转速均方差sqrerr值最小。幅值amp和相位phase的初值可以根据图2中的发电机的转矩波动的幅值和相位来确定。
16.如图2所示,正弦波发生器输出的调整转矩t_delt的频率与发动机转矩脉动的频率相同。
17.如图3所示,调整转矩t_delt需要根据电机的输出转矩能力进行最大值限制和最小值限制。
18.如图2所示,自适应调节器在调整幅值amp和相位phase时优先调整相位phase。
19.以上述依据本发明的理想实施例为启示,通过上述的说明内容,相关工作人员完全可以在不偏离本项发明技术思想的范围内,进行多样的变更以及修改。凡在本发明的精神和原则之内,所做的任何修改、等同替换、改进等,均应包含在本发明的保护范围之内。本项发明的技术性范围并不局限于说明书上的内容,必须要根据权利要求范围来确定其技术性范围。


技术特征:
1.一种发动机抖动抑制的方法,其特征在于:包括以下步骤:s1:用正弦波发生器输出调整转矩t_delt;s2:输出的调整转矩t_delt经过加法器与正常电机控制转矩t_cmd相加后得到最终电机转矩输出值t_real并将最终电机转矩输出值t_real给到电机;s3:速度传感器得到电机转速spd,并对电机转速spd进行均方差计算得到转速均方差sqrerr;s4:自适应调节器根据转速均方差sqrerr来调整正弦波发生器输出调整转矩t_delt的幅值amp和相位phase,以使得转速均方差sqrerr值最小。2.根据权利要求1所述的一种发动机抖动抑制的方法,其特征在于:正弦波发生器输出的调整转矩t_delt的频率与发动机转矩脉动的频率相同。3.根据权利要求2所述的一种发动机抖动抑制的方法,其特征在于:所述调整转矩t_delt需要根据电机的输出转矩能力进行最大值限制和最小值限制。4.根据权利要求3所述的一种发动机抖动抑制的方法,其特征在于:自适应调节器在调整幅值amp和相位phase时优先调整相位phase。

技术总结
本发明涉及汽车发动机技术领域,尤其是一种发动机抖动抑制的方法,通过调整电机的输出转矩来实现发动机转矩平滑功能,其基本思想是增加一个电机的补偿转矩来抑制电机的转矩脉动,本发明通过调整电机的输出转矩来实现发动机转矩的平滑,抑制发动机的转矩脉动,减少机械系统振动,延长机械使用寿命,提升舒适性,优先调节相位,保证补偿转矩刚好削弱发动机的抖动,然后再调正弦波幅值,使得抖动抑制的效果最佳。最佳。最佳。


技术研发人员:许峻峰
受保护的技术使用者:江苏洛伦兹新能源科技有限公司
技术研发日:2021.12.30
技术公布日:2022/3/8

最新回复(0)